#!/usr/bin/env python import wx ## import the installed version from wx.lib.floatcanvas import NavCanvas, FloatCanvas ## import a local version #import sys #sys.path.append("../") #from floatcanvas import NavCanvas, FloatCanvas class DrawFrame(wx.Frame): """ A frame used for the FloatCanvas Demo """ def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s): wx.Frame.__init__(self, *args, **kwargs) self.CreateStatusBar() # Add the Canvas Canvas = NavCanvas.NavCanvas(self,-1, size = (500,500), ProjectionFun = None, Debug = 0, BackgroundColor = "DARK SLATE BLUE", ).Canvas self.Canvas = Canvas self.Canvas.Bind(FloatCanvas.EVT_MOTION, self.OnMove) Pts = ((45,40), (20, 15), (10, 40), (30,30)) Points = Canvas.AddPointSet(Pts, Diameter=3, Color="Red") Points.HitLineWidth = 10 Points.Bind(FloatCanvas.EVT_FC_ENTER_OBJECT, self.OnOverPoints) Points.Bind(FloatCanvas.EVT_FC_LEAVE_OBJECT, self.OnLeavePoints) Points.Bind(FloatCanvas.EVT_FC_LEFT_DOWN, self.OnLeftDown) self.Show() Canvas.ZoomToBB() def OnOverPoints(self, obj): print "Mouse over point: ", obj.FindClosestPoint(obj.HitCoords) def OnLeavePoints(self, obj): print "Mouse left point: ", obj.FindClosestPoint(obj.HitCoords) def OnLeftDown(self, obj): print "Mouse left down on point: ", obj.FindClosestPoint(obj.HitCoords) def OnMove(self, event): """ Updates the status bar with the world coordinates """ self.SetStatusText("%.2f, %.2f"%tuple(event.Coords)) app = wx.App(False) F = DrawFrame(None, title="FloatCanvas Demo App", size=(700,700) ) app.MainLoop()
